Output d58a05ab6428b29c190820b0f3c986ae6abcd15a51c903f206fafc7d7f3993ee:1

value
5865000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c56269777349917a12d0e6516b7d8ab50aa7c57 OP_EQUALVERIFY OP_CHECKSIG
address
16W2kNPawuRrX38ee9igy1uRDcoMADT8kJ
transaction
d58a05ab6428b29c190820b0f3c986ae6abcd15a51c903f206fafc7d7f3993ee
spent
true